Determine whether each statement best describes capitalism or mercantilism.
Answer:
Explanation: The correct answer is the following.
The correct matches are:
It is an economic system that relies on a free market: Capitalism.
The government is in control of the nation’s economy: Mercantilism.
In requires a nation to export goods worth more than goods is imports: Mercantilism.
The government doesn’t get involved in the economy: Capitalism.
Mercantilism was the economic system used from the 16th to the 18th century. Europeans governments accumulated as much wealth as they could because they considered that wealth has a limit. The government imposed economic regulations in its producti activities. Capitalism is the economic system that supports companies doing business to generate earnings and promote the economy of a nation. Capitalism believes in free trade and the non-intervention of the government.

Which answer best explains the Cherokee's main argument against Georgia in Cherokee Nation v. Georgia?
A. The Cherokee argued they had legally bought their land from other tribes.
B. The Cherokee argued they were a separate nation and not bound by state laws.
C. The Cherokee argued they had already signed an agreement with the federal government.
D. The Cherokee argued they had given all their land to the missions so Georgia had no case.
Answer:
The Cherokee argued they were a separate nation and not bound by state laws.
Explanation:
Cherokee Nation v. Georgia, it was a case of the Supreme Court of the United States. The Cherokee Nation applied for a federal court order against the laws passed by the State of Georgia of the United States. UU That deprived them of rights within their limits, but the Supreme Court did not hear the case on its merits. It was ruled that he had no original jurisdiction in the matter, since the Cherokees were a dependent nation, with a relationship to the United States as that of a "ward to his guardian," as Judge Marshall said

British-educated lawyer who helped lead India’s freedom movement
Answer:
Mohandas Ghandi
Explanation:
Mahatma Gandhi, a British-educated lawyer, was a key figure in the Indian independence struggle. In India, Gandhi is frequently referred to as the Father of the Nation. In India's fight for independence from British colonial authority, he was a key player.
After seizing control of the Indian National Congress in 1921, Gandhi led efforts to eradicate untouchability, combat poverty, advance women's rights, promote interethnic and interreligious peace, and most importantly achieve swaraj or self-rule. Gandhi chose to wear a short, hand-spun dhoti as a sign of his affinity for India's rural underclass.
He began to live in an autonomous residential community, eat little food, and observe lengthy fasts as a form of introspection and political protest. By spearheading the 400 km (250 mi) Dandi Salt March in 1930 and the 1942 call for the British to leave India, Gandhi helped anti-colonial nationalism become more widely accepted among common Indians.

Trade can be defined as a process which typically involves the buying and selling of goods and services between a producer and the customers (consumers) at a specific period of time.
The East Indian Company was founded by John Watts on the 31st of December, 1600 with its headquarters in London, United Kingdom.
In 1600, the company acquired a royal charter from the Queen of England (Queen Elizabeth I) and as such had the sole right to trade with the East Indies.
In 1651, the first English factory was set up on the banks of Hugli in Bengal, near a village called Kalikata in India.
The difference between CapitalistDemocracies and Soviet Communism.
Answer:
In a capitalist state, the economy is largely free from state control, while the government is democratically elected and freedom of speech is cherished. In contrast, a communist state is administered from the centre, with control of the economy and society strictly in the hands of the Communist Party-led government.
